This is a black-and-white portrait of a bearded man in fancy clothes. He’s wearing a large, ornate collar and a crown above his shoulder. One hand holds a globe, and the other rests on a staff with a cross on top. Behind him is a shield with a coat of arms. The text at the bottom calls him "Rudolph II" and lists his titles. The artist’s name, Giacomo Franco, is also there. Next, look up engraving to see how this kind of printmaking works.
